Raksha Bandhan is a festival that is celebrated by Hindus all around the world. The word Raksha Bandhan means ‘a bond of protection’. This day celebrates the special bond between brothers and sisters. On this day, sisters tie a decorated bracelet or sacred thread around the wrists of their brothers and apply tilak on their foreheads. They also, pray for the good health and long lives of their brothers. The brothers, in return, promise to protect them forever. 

Raksha Bandhan usually falls in August. This year, we celebrate Raksha Bandhan on August 30 and 31. 

There are several stories of the origin of Raksha Bandhan. One of them is tied to the Hindu mythological legend of the Mahabharata. According to the legend, Lord Krishna had accidentally injured his finger while using the Sudarshan Chakra. To stop the bleeding, Draupadi, the wife of the Pandavas, tore off a piece of her saree and wrapped it securely around the wound. Touched by the act, Lord Krishna promised to protect her always. Sometime after this, when Draupadi was humiliated in the royal court of Hastinapur, Lord Krishna saved her honour. 

This festival is not only limited to brothers and sisters. It can be celebrated between sisters, sisters-in-law, nephews, nieces and other relations.
